What owners report

  • Aluminum rear differential corroded, causing Haldex fluid to leak out resulting in Haldex pump, failure and loss of rear-wheel-drive ie.(4 motion) causing catastrophic failure of clutch pack.

    filed Jul 27, 2026

  • Hi- I have an atlas 2021 Volkswagen Atlas- that was recently serviced for a transmission leak. According to my mechanic, the leak was the result of the plastic cowling rubbing against the cooling tube and after 100k miles the tube wore through. This seems to be a design flaw or defect in the…

    filed Mar 17, 2026
